Added BattlePokemon#isGrounded to check for the grounded-ness of a
Pokemon. Also BattlePokemon#isSemiInvulnerable for whether a Pokemon is
in the first turn of a two-turn move that makes them semi-invulnerable.
Fixed Terrain bugs involving Pokemon in a semi-invulnerable state.
Changed OHKO move check to use BattlePokemon#isSemiInvulnerable, fixing a
graphical bug that would display an immunity message when a Pokemon
attempted an OHKO move on a higher-leveled Pokemon that was being held by
the effect of Sky Drop.
Fixed Misty Terrain bug that was causing Rest and the effect of Yawn to
put Pokemon to sleep.
Fixed Misty Terrain bug that was causing Yawn to fail.
Fixed Electric Terrain bug that was causing Yawn to succeed.

Set up moves to track the type effectiveness of the move for purposes of
'Hit' and 'ModifyDamage' events. This fixes various glitches resulting
from Pokemon with the 'IgnoreEffectiveness' flag set for some types, and
also is a slight optimization because it removes the need to run the
'Effectiveness' event one more time to check effectiveness in the moves.
While move.affectedByImmunities was always a Boolean value to denote if
the move was affected by immunities, move.ignoreImmunity can be a Boolean
value if it ignores or is affected by all type immunities, but also can
act as an object such that !!move.ignoreImmunity[type] means it ignores
immunities of that type.
Added a new event, ModifyWeight, to deal with weight changes from items,
abilities, and moves. Add a function getWeight to call the event and
return a Pokemon's current weight.
The 'EndAbility' event was initially introduced for the implementation of
new weathers in ORAS, like Desolate Land, but has since been depreciated
in favor of an 'End' singleEvent.
Pickup was not retrieving items consumed by allies, was picking up items
from nonadjacent foes, and had a chance of failing to retrieve an item
from a foe if the other one had not used its item that turn. Pickup now
queries all eligible Pokemon before randomly choosing one of the items to
pick up, instead of choosing the target before checking whether it had an
item that could be retrieved.
Switched Unburden's onUseItem handler to onAfterUseItem instead, and set
Natural Gift, Air Balloon and Fling to send AfterUseItem events when the
items are removed. Sending these events also has the side effect of fixing
some of the functionality with Symbiosis not giving items when these moves
consume their items.

Moved all checks for primal weather into setWeather() instead of
hard-coding the check into every effect attempting to change the weather.
Also to prevent hardcoding, the check now runs on the event system, and
the primal weathers themselves deny regular weathers from being set.
